Teenage Team Of Girl Engineers Designs Solar-Powered Tent To Tackle Homelessness

2/11/2019

0 Comments

 
Never question what a group of innovative young minds can do when they invest their energy into problem solving!  Check out this story about how a DIY Girls team developed a solar-powered tent to address homelessness, an issue that is especially relevant in their community.
